LCOV - differential code coverage report
Current view: top level - contrib/pgcrypto Coverage Total Hit UNC UBC GNC CBC DUB DCB
Current: Differential Code Coverage 16@8cea358b128 vs 17@8cea358b128 Lines: 85.9 % 4468 3839 13 616 32 3807 20 41
Current Date: 2024-04-14 14:21:10 Functions: 96.2 % 318 306 2 10 17 289 2
Baseline: 16@8cea358b128 Branches: 61.1 % 2740 1673 2 1065 2 1671
Baseline Date: 2024-04-14 14:21:09 Line coverage date bins:
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% [..60] days: 68.8 % 16 11 5 11
(60,120] days: 100.0 % 1 1 1
(120,180] days: 75.0 % 32 24 8 18 6
(240..) days: 86.1 % 4419 3803 616 3 3800
Function coverage date bins:
(120,180] days: 75.0 % 8 6 2 6
(240..) days: 96.8 % 310 300 10 11 289
Branch coverage date bins:
(60,120] days: 50.0 % 2 1 1 1
(120,180] days: 50.0 % 4 2 2 2
(240..) days: 61.1 % 2734 1670 1064 1670

File Sort by file name Line Coverage ( hide details )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it UNC UBC GNC CBC DUB DCB Rate Total Hit UNC UBC GNC CBC Rate Total Hit UNC UBC GNC CBC DCB
crypt-blowfish.c
96.9%96.9%
96.9 % 162 157 5 157 66.7 % 96 64 32 64 100.0 % 5 5 5
<unnamed> 96.9 % 162 157 157 66.7 % 96 64 64 100.0 % 5 5 5
crypt-des.c
95.4%95.4%
95.4 % 285 272 13 272 87.3 % 134 117 17 117 100.0 % 7 7 7
<unnamed> 95.4 % 285 272 272 87.3 % 134 117 117 100.0 % 7 7 7
crypt-gensalt.c
83.7%83.7%
83.7 % 98 82 16 82 41.4 % 58 24 34 24 100.0 % 5 5 5
<unnamed> 83.7 % 98 82 82 41.4 % 58 24 24 100.0 % 5 5 5
crypt-md5.c
94.8%94.8%
94.8 % 77 73 4 73 82.4 % 34 28 6 28 100.0 % 2 2 2
<unnamed> 94.8 % 77 73 73 82.4 % 34 28 28 100.0 % 2 2 2
mbuf.c
93.6%93.6%
93.6 % 219 205 14 205 82.1 % 84 69 15 69 100.0 % 24 24 24
<unnamed> 93.6 % 219 205 205 82.1 % 84 69 69 100.0 % 24 24 24
openssl.c
82.8%82.8%
82.8 % 291 241 8 42 20 221 15 29 58.6 % 116 68 2 46 2 66 93.3 % 30 28 2 8 20 2
<unnamed> 82.8 % 291 241 20 221 58.6 % 116 68 2 66 93.3 % 30 28 8 20
pgcrypto.c
93.4%93.4%
93.4 % 183 171 12 171 35.3 % 266 94 172 94 91.7 % 24 22 2 22
<unnamed> 93.4 % 183 171 171 35.3 % 266 94 94 91.7 % 24 22 22
pgp-armor.c
89.2%89.2%
89.2 % 231 206 25 206 72.6 % 168 122 46 122 100.0 % 10 10 10
<unnamed> 89.2 % 231 206 206 72.6 % 168 122 122 100.0 % 10 10 10
pgp-cfb.c
95.1%95.1%
95.1 % 103 98 5 98 88.0 % 50 44 6 44 100.0 % 9 9 9
<unnamed> 95.1 % 103 98 98 88.0 % 50 44 44 100.0 % 9 9 9
pgp-compress.c
86.4%86.4%
86.4 % 125 108 17 1 107 1 73.2 % 56 41 15 41 100.0 % 11 11 1 10
<unnamed> 86.4 % 125 108 1 107 73.2 % 56 41 41 100.0 % 11 11 1 10
pgp-decrypt.c
80.1%80.1%
80.1 % 558 447 111 447 64.4 % 320 206 114 206 100.0 % 31 31 31
<unnamed> 80.1 % 558 447 447 64.4 % 320 206 206 100.0 % 31 31 31
pgp-encrypt.c
87.6%87.6%
87.6 % 298 261 37 261 68.4 % 136 93 43 93 100.0 % 25 25 25
<unnamed> 87.6 % 298 261 261 68.4 % 136 93 93 100.0 % 25 25 25
pgp-info.c
77.7%77.7%
77.7 % 103 80 23 80 62.3 % 61 38 23 38 100.0 % 4 4 4
<unnamed> 77.7 % 103 80 80 62.3 % 61 38 38 100.0 % 4 4 4
pgp-mpi-openssl.c
83.2%83.2%
83.2 % 161 134 27 134 50.0 % 146 73 73 73 100.0 % 7 7 7
<unnamed> 83.2 % 161 134 134 50.0 % 146 73 73 100.0 % 7 7 7
pgp-mpi.c
91.1%91.1%
91.1 % 56 51 5 51 66.7 % 18 12 6 12 100.0 % 7 7 7
<unnamed> 91.1 % 56 51 51 66.7 % 18 12 12 100.0 % 7 7 7
pgp-pgsql.c
87.6%87.6%
87.6 % 461 404 5 52 11 393 5 11 54.0 % 528 285 243 285 90.0 % 40 36 4 8 28
<unnamed> 87.6 % 461 404 11 393 54.0 % 528 285 285 90.0 % 40 36 8 28
pgp-pubdec.c
74.3%74.3%
74.3 % 101 75 26 75 56.1 % 57 32 25 32 100.0 % 5 5 5
<unnamed> 74.3 % 101 75 75 56.1 % 57 32 32 100.0 % 5 5 5
pgp-pubenc.c
84.1%84.1%
84.1 % 113 95 18 95 57.4 % 47 27 20 27 100.0 % 5 5 5
<unnamed> 84.1 % 113 95 95 57.4 % 47 27 27 100.0 % 5 5 5
pgp-pubkey.c
72.1%72.1%
72.1 % 333 240 93 240 58.5 % 159 93 66 93 100.0 % 9 9 9
<unnamed> 72.1 % 333 240 240 58.5 % 159 93 93 100.0 % 9 9 9
pgp-s2k.c
91.2%91.2%
91.2 % 148 135 13 135 79.0 % 62 49 13 49 100.0 % 7 7 7
<unnamed> 91.2 % 148 135 135 79.0 % 62 49 49 100.0 % 7 7 7
pgp.c
79.3%79.3%
79.3 % 135 107 28 107 57.4 % 54 31 23 31 91.7 % 24 22 2 22
<unnamed> 79.3 % 135 107 107 57.4 % 54 31 31 91.7 % 24 22 22
px-crypt.c
87.2%87.2%
87.2 % 39 34 5 34 73.3 % 30 22 8 22 100.0 % 5 5 5
<unnamed> 87.2 % 39 34 34 73.3 % 30 22 22 100.0 % 5 5 5
px-hmac.c
86.1%86.1%
86.1 % 72 62 10 62 87.5 % 8 7 1 7 75.0 % 8 6 2 6
<unnamed> 86.1 % 72 62 62 87.5 % 8 7 7 75.0 % 8 6 6
px.c
87.1%87.1%
87.1 % 116 101 15 101 65.4 % 52 34 18 34 100.0 % 14 14 14
<unnamed> 87.1 % 116 101 101 65.4 % 52 34 34 100.0 % 14 14 14

Generated by: LCOV version 2.1-beta2-3-g6141622